On "The Human Condition," Bellion's eclecticism is on full display. Tracks like "All Time Low" and "Overemotional" showcase his ability to craft infectious, pop-infused hooks, while songs like "Stupid Deep" and "The Way I Am" reveal his hip-hop and R&B roots. The album's production is marked by its use of live instrumentation, found sounds, and innovative electronic processing techniques.

Throughout "The Human Condition", Bellion draws on a wide range of influences, from hip-hop and R&B to electronic and pop music. The album's production is characterized by its use of atmospheric synths, driving beats, and introspective melodies, creating a sonic landscape that is both futuristic and timeless.

One of the standout tracks from the album is "All Time Low", which features a haunting melody and poignant lyrics that explore the highs and lows of life. Overall, "The Human Condition" is a remarkable album that showcases Jon Bellion's innovative approach to music and his thought-provoking lyrics. The album's themes of self-discovery, existentialism, and the search for meaning are universally relatable, making it a must-listen for fans of hip-hop, pop, and electronic music.
